Foundations 2
Students will improve their speaking, listening, vocabulary and basic sentence writing skills
Foundations 3
Students will strengthen their speaking and listening skills so they can express themselves in simple conversations. Students will read basic stories and be able to write a short paragraph.
Foundations 4
Students will improve their conversation skills so they can express themselves clearly in everyday conversations. Students will read a variety of texts and apply basic reading strategies as well as write short well-developed paragraphs.
Foundations 5
Students will express their ideas in sustained conversations on variety of topics. Students will read a variety of texts and improve their comprehension. Students will write narrative, descriptive, and expository multi-paragraph compositions.
Foundations 6
Students will read increasingly complex texts and improve their comprehension. Students will write multi-paragraph narrative, descriptive and expository essays using the writing process.
Foundations 7
Students will develop oral fluency and express themselves clearly in sustained conversations. Students will read a variety of literary and informational texts to increase comprehension and write well-developed essays.
Our Literacy Foundations classes include both Face-to-Face and asynchronous online instruction using Microsoft Teams.
